As you begin searching for home loans, double check your credit and work to get it in tip-top shape. A not-so-great credit score might mean you are presented with a higher interest rate on your loan. On the other hand, a high credit score can help you secure a better rate with your potential lender. Your credit history, financial situation, and the timing in which you wish to make your move can all affect the type of home loan that fits your needs. So, what loans can you pick from?
Different Types of Home Loans in Anthem, AZ
You may have options when it comes to Anthem home loans: conventional loans, FHA loans, FHA streamline loans, VA loans, VA Interest Rate Reduction Loans (VA IRRRL), and high balance conforming loans. A conventional loans might be a good choice for you if you're ready to make a down payment of at least 3% (depending on your situation), your credit is healthy, and your income and employment history are stable.
FHA and VA loans are both classified as government loans. Credit and income requirements are often different criteria than conventional loans. Also, active-duty service members, veterans and surviving spouses may be eligible to apply for VA new home loans. Which one of these home loans is a good fit for you? Begin in Anthem, AZ with a Preapproval Letter
Secure a Verified Approval Letter from the lender before you start going to Open Houses in Anthem to show that you've done your due diligence. A Verified Approval Letter is evidence that the lender has reviewed your finances and has given you an estimate of how much you can buy. The letter can also carry more weight with the real estate agent and seller because they know you can afford the home.
